The size of Beenleigh is approximately 7.7 square kilometres. It has 23 parks covering nearly 17.5% of total area. The population of Beenleigh in 2016 was 8252 people. By 2021 the population was 8425 showing a population growth of 2.1%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Beenleigh is 20-29 years. Households in Beenleigh are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Beenleigh work in a labourer occupation.In 2021, 43.80% of the homes in Beenleigh were owner-occupied compared with 43.40% in 2016.
